Business Analyst (Ref. STHL1902)

Key Responsibilities:

  • Financial Modeling & Projection: Manage and coordinate the preparation of the group’s cash flow projections at both the subsidiary and consolidated holding levels. Build dynamic financial, valuation, and sensitivity models.

  • Research & Deep-Dives: Conduct rigorous market, equity, and industry research on potential investment projects, synthesizing complex data into clear, actionable insights.

  • Strategic Presentation: Translate financial data and research findings into polished, executive-ready PowerPoint presentations and proposals for senior leadership.

  • Transaction & Advisory Support: Assist in due diligence studies, evaluate investment projects, and provide analytical support for corporate finance transactions.

  • Cross-Functional Liaison: Work closely with internal business units, external professionals, and business partners to facilitate transaction execution.

  • Perform ad-hoc projects/ duties when required

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business or Finance or related disciplines.

  • Relevant experience in investment related fields is an advantage, high capability, adaptability, and the right skill set are prioritized over years of experience.

  •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el, including financial modeling, forecasting, and complex data analysis.

  • Strong presentation skills with the ability to structure a compelling narrative and design clean, professional decks for executive viewing.

  • Proficient in leveraging AI tools (e.g., ChatGPT, Gemini, Copilot) to enhance research efficiency, generate insights, and streamline analytical workflows.

  • Strong business acumen with the ability to interpret financial data in a commercial context.

  • Proactive mindset with a demonstrated passion for continuous learning and professional development.

  • Fluent in written and spoken English and Chinese (including Mandarin).
